Prior to Miami
Named Kentucky’s Miss Basketball for 2001 ... led the state of Kentucky in scoring as a senior, averaging 27.4 points per game, after coming back from off-season surgery on both knees ... finished high school career with a record 2,917 points ... also set school records for points in a game (42) and points in a season (880) ... first-team all-conference, all-district and all-region selection all four years of her prep career ... three-time MVP of the All-State “A” Tournament ... helped Bishop Brossart to the state title as a sophomore ... two-time Street & Smith all-American ... three-time Associated Press first-team all-state selection ... named Kentucky Player of the year by Pepsi Cola and Gatorade ... honored as La Rosa’s Cincinnati Area Female Athlete of the Year ... received the J.B. Mansfield Award as top girls basketball student-athlete in Kentucky ... also an all-state track and cross country performer while in high school.
